First iPhone app released

Available on the App Store iTunes Connect - iKeyword Last Wednesday first iPhone app was released under my account, iKeyword. iKeyword allows you to search for related keywords on your iPhone or iPod Touch. I use Google AdWords keyword suggestion API to discover/generate keywords. It was a fun project.
